MetaTrader 5 (MT5) Trading Platform: Advantages and Disadvantages

Posted on 2023-04-21

MetaTrader 5 (MT5) is a popular trading platform, particularly for Forex trading. It is the successor of M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and was designed to provide additional features and functionalities. Here are some advantages and disadvantages of using MT5:

Advantages:

Multi-asset trading: MT5 allows users to trade multiple asset classes, including Forex, stocks, futures, and options, from a single platform.

Advanced charting: The platform offers advanced charting capabilities, including the ability to display up to 100 charts simultaneously, and 21 timeframes, allowing for more in-depth technical analysis.

Economic calendar: MT5 includes an economic calendar that displays important news releases and events, which can help traders make informed decisions.

Built-in market analysis tools: MT5 includes built-in market analysis tools, including indicators, expert advisors, and scripts.

Strategy tester: MT5 has a powerful backtesting and optimization tool that allows traders to test their strategies before implementing them in live markets.

Disadvantages:

Limited adoption: MT5 is not as widely used as MT4, so finding brokers that offer it as a trading platform may be more challenging.

Limited customizability: MT5 does not allow for as much customization as MT4, particularly when it comes to writing custom indicators and expert advisors.

Resource-intensive: MT5 is more resource-intensive than MT4, requiring more powerful hardware to run smoothly.

Changes in programming language: The programming language used in MT5, MQL5, is different from the one used in MT4, MQL4. This means that traders who have programmed custom indicators and expert advisors for MT4 will need to rewrite them for MT5.

Overall, MT5 is a powerful trading platform that offers advanced features and functionality. However, its limited adoption and resource requirements may make it less appealing to some traders.
